From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913) (web1913)

Prosthesis \Pros"the*sis\, n. [L., fr. Gr. ? an addition, fr. ?
to put to, to add; ? to + ? to put, place.]
1. (Surg.) The addition to the human body of some artificial
part, to replace one that is wanting, as a log or an eye;
-- called also {prothesis}.

2. (Gram.) The prefixing of one or more letters to the
beginning of a word, as in beloved.
